Title

DEEP CHAIN VOTE: SECURE BLOCKCHAIN-BIOMETRIC VOTING

Authors

Abstract

This paper presents a secure and transparent voting framework that integrates blockchain technology with deep learning–based fingerprint recognition. The immutable and decentralized architecture of blockchain ensures that all votes are recorded in a tamper-proof ledger, eliminating the possibility of unauthorized modifications or deletion of voting records. To strengthen voter authentication, the system employs a deep learning–enhanced fingerprint recognition model, enabling highly accurate and reliable verification. This biometric layer prevents impersonation, duplicate voting, and other fraudulent activities by ensuring that only legitimate voters can participate in the election process. Once authenticated, the voter’s choice is securely submitted and permanently stored on the blockchain, where it becomes accessible for real-time monitoring by authorized stakeholders. This decentralized structure supports independent auditability while preserving voter privacy and anonymity. Overall, this paper aims to improve voter confidence and accessibility by offering a modern, secure, and scalable voting solution. By combining blockchain with advanced biometric authentication, the system significantly reduces electoral fraud, enhances transparency, and supports fair and reliable elections across various administrative levels.
